|
|
|
There are various use cases that need groups to be defined locally, for instance:
- workspace templates that include some standard ACLs and where the groups to which they apply will be customized locally,
- workflow that manages permissions for a standard group defined locally.
To do that we need to introduce a local (in-ACP) definition of a group. This generalizes the notion of "owner" that is already in the spec.
The indexing will have to take local groups into account too.
Open questions:
- can a local group override a higher-level local group? Do we want to just "extend" it sometimes? Do we want exclusions?
- can a local group override a global group? Same questions as above.
- do we want to introduce the term "role"? Just in the UI?
|
|
|
|
![]() |
|
_______________________________________________
ECM-tickets mailing list
[email protected]
http://lists.nuxeo.com/mailman/listinfo/ecm-tickets